Participation in a round table within the Erasmus+ Jean Monnet project “EU Sustainable Development Policy: Experience for Ukrainian Cities and Regions in Decentralization” (07.02.2023, online)

On February 7, 2023, National Erasmus+ Office in Ukraine joined round table within the Erasmus+ Jean Monnet project “EU Sustainable Development Policy: Experience for Ukrainian Cities and Regions in Decentralization”.

More than 90 participants took part in Zoom, including HEIs staff and employees of the structural units of the State Tax University, winners of the EU Erasmus+ Jean Monnet module projects from different organisations of Ukraine, researchers from EU, stakeholders, local government bodies and public organizations, and students.

NEO – Ukraine Coordinator, Svitlana SHYTIKOVA, congratulated the team on success in a tough competition and thanked for their hard work, support of partners during the difficult time of challenges and consequences of martial law in Ukraine. Speaker emphasized the main priorities during the project implementation with a focus on overcoming the challenges and consequences of war; importance of modern and innovative content, methodologies, resources and results, as well as inclusiveness and the use of digital and green technologies.

As a result of the event, Svitlana SHYTIKOVA emphasized the rules of the Programme regarding the implementation of Jean Monnet projects, financial management, issues of integrity, and also presented successful cases of the implementation of Erasmus+ projects during the war in Ukraine.
